    I do about the same but with a twist. Take a # 10 cast iron skillet , add some bacon that has been cut into 1/2 to 3/4 inch pieces Just lay the strip of bacon out and cut it every 1/2 or 3/4 inch. Cook the pieces so you have some grease. Now add hamburger ( lean ) and cook it with the Bacon pieces. When the hamburger is done add the number of eggs you want and scramble them in the Hamburger and bacon chunks. When they are done plate them and season to your liking. Rule of thumb...About 1/3 to 1/2 pound of hamburger per person , eggs and bacon per person is the cooks choice. If you want to remove some of the bacon grease after it's cooked , again it's the cooks choice.
